The assertion that decibels never represent a negative value is incorrect because decibels can, in fact, have negative values depending on the context in which they are used. For example, when measuring sound intensity, decibels are often referenced against a standard level of sound pressure, and values below this threshold are expressed as negative decibels. This logarithmic scale means that decibels can effectively represent very low levels of sound or power, allowing for a wide range of values including those below zero.
